“Born in the beautiful city of Cape Town and raised along the Garden Route in quiet George I had a blessed upbringing. Studying at City Varsity in Cape Town I obtained a diploma in Acting for Camera. This was the beginning of the discovery of my voice and laid the foundation for me as a performer. I spent a year working at Madame Zingara’s Theatre Of Dreams, dressing guests up to be part of that fantasy spectacular. This is where I met the fabulous Irit Noble. After leaving MZ we started our journey together. I began as Irit’s PA, and shortly thereafter was doubling as her back up vocalist for our Disco DivaLicious show which ran at On Broadway in Cape Town. And then the Love Divas were born! This is where I realized my passion for using my voice as a performer and to spread only positivity and big love through speaking and singing.

passionately positive Love Diva K ~ Kim West
A 3rd year Advance Diploma in Acting for Camera obtained at City Varsity in Cape Town paved the way for vivacious Kim West. Co-writing and starring in Dumshow, Rob Murray’s jaw dropping, unconventional play at the Standard Bank National Arts Festival in Grahamstown in 2006. 2007 saw Kim further pushing her physical boundaries as the lead in the London production of Three Nights, directed by Leigh Tredger.
At the age of 23, nature girl Miss Kim says she was "Oh so right for the picking as one of Irit Noble's Love Divas…” bringing her open-hearted generosity, genuine desire to serve others and her unique, raw ‘so not your everyday’ skills as a poetess to inspire others.
